#DFEA95 Color
#DFEA95 is rgb(223, 234, 149) in RGB, hsl(68, 67%, 75%) in HSL, and about cmyk(5%, 0%, 36%, 8%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Medium Spring Bud (#C9DC87), clearly related but distinguishable side by side at ΔE 6.38. Black text is the more readable choice on this background.

#DFEA95 Channel Values
How #DFEA95 bre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 223 · G 234 · B 149 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 68° · S 67% · L 75%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 68° · S 36% · V 92%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 5% · M 0% · Y 36% · K 8%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 1.29:1 vs white · 16.34: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|
Text Contrast & Accessibility
WCAG 2.2 contrast ratios for text on a #DFEA95 background. AA requires 4.5:1 for normal text and 3:1 for large text; AAA requires 7:1. Contrast is one check, not a full accessibility review.

#DFEA95 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#DFEA95?
#DFEA95 is a light green — rgb(223, 234, 149) in RGB and hsl(68, 67%, 75%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Medium Spring Bud (#C9DC87), which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side at a CIE76 distance of 6.38.
What is the RGB value of #DFEA95?
#DFEA95 is rgb(223, 234, 149) — red 223, green 234, and blue 149 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#DFEA95?
#DFEA95 converts to approximately cmyk(5%, 0%, 36%, 8%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#DFEA95 be black or white?
Black text is the more readable choice. #DFEA95 scores 1.29:1 against white and 16.34: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#DFEA95 as a CSS color keyword?
No. #DFEA95 is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is khaki (#F0E68C) at a CIE76 distance of 9.21, which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side.
